# Watchdog config — Perchpoint kiosk app
# Heads up for the security review: the watchdog pings the UI process
# every 10s and hard-restarts it after three misses. Restart events,
# tamper flags, and screen-freeze incidents all get logged to the
# central audit table so the Ops crew at the Dunmore depot can spot
# flaky units. Yes, the watchdog has its own DB credentials, scoped
# to insert-only on audit tables. It reaches the audit database using
# the connection string just below.

primary connection of yagep-kahip = redis://giliel_svc:zYiKsLL2PLpfPL@db-348f.xolmarsys.corp:5432/fenwyn

TICKET-4471: PortionWise scaling API returning 401s since 02:10. The recipe-scaling calculator can't reach the unit-conversion backend because the service credential expired overnight. Rotation job in CredSpin failed silently — see job log. Impact: all scale-up/scale-down requests fail; cached conversions still serve. Fix: rotate via CredSpin console, redeploy portionwise-calc, verify /healthz. Temporary key below is valid for 24h; use it to unblock staging while rotation completes.

service key, bafop-kafop: qvz2-us

Subject: DR drill results — autocomplete index

Team, for the weekly sync: Thursday's disaster-recovery drill covered the Quillsearch autocomplete index, which has been slow since the region migration. Failover to the Marrow Bay standby completed in 11 minutes, but the warm-up left suggestions degraded for another 20. We're adding a pre-warmed shadow index to close that gap. One action item: the standby's sealed keystore delayed us; to unseal it during future drills, use the recovery passphrase below.

strongbox words: prawyn-fenmir